2016 PLN to AUD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2016

During 2016, the PLN to AUD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on January 10, valuing the pair at 0.3607.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 4, dropping to 0.3179.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0428 AUD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.3517 to the December average rate of 0.3241, the exchange rate registered a net change of -7.85%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2016 high of 0.3607 was down 5.59% compared to the 2015 peak of 0.3820,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.3607 0.3453 0.3517
February 0.3601 0.3476 0.3544
March 0.3495 0.3405 0.3457
April 0.3542 0.3317 0.3434
May 0.3541 0.3428 0.3509
June 0.3533 0.3345 0.3453
July 0.3381 0.3289 0.3342
August 0.3451 0.3389 0.3418
September 0.3465 0.3371 0.3419
October 0.3442 0.3296 0.3364
November 0.3353 0.3205 0.3265
December 0.3317 0.3179 0.3241
